Коммутатор
Изобретение относится к вычислительной и коммутационной технике. Цель изобретения - повьппение быстродействия и.расширение функциональных возможностей устройства. Коммутатор содержит М-плат 1.1-1.М коммутации , N-входных измерительных сигналов , счетчики 2 и 3, дешифраторы 4 и 5, задающий генератор 6, блок 7 временной задержки, управляемый высокочастотный генератор 10, блок II запрета, элементы И 12 и 13, элементы ИЛИ 14, 15 и 16, триггер 18 и переключающие устройства 21 и 22. Введение аналогового переключателя 8, блока 9 управления, элемента ИЛИ 17, формирователей 19 и 20, блоков 23 и 24 сквозного переноса и образование новых функциональных связей позволяет уменьшить время аналого-цифровых преобразователей, а автоматизация процесса предварительной установки номеров плат и каналов измерения на них, участвующих в процессе измерения , расширяет круг задач, решаемых (Л на аналого-цифровых вычислительных комплексах. 4 ил.
СО1ОЗ СОНЕТСНИХ
СОЦИАЛИСТИЧЕСНИХ
РЕСПУБЛИН
А1,ЛК„12724 (51)4 Н 03 K 17 00
ОПИСАНИЕ ИЗОБРЕТЕНИЯ
ГОСУДАРСТВЕННЫЙ НОМИТЕТ СССР
Г1О 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
К А ВТОРСКОМУ СВИДЕТЕЛЬСТВУ (21) 3879576/24-21 (22) 08.04.85 (46) 23.11.86. Бюл. У 43 (72) А.С. Тарлажану (53) 621.382(088.8) (56) Авторское свидетельство СССР
Ф 790304, кл. Н 03 К 17/00, 1979.
Авторское свидетельство СССР
Ф 934579, кл. H,ОЗ К 17/00, 1981. (54) КОММУТАТОР (57) Изобретение относится к вычислительной и коммутационной технике.
Цель изобретения — повышение быстродействия и.расширение функциональных возможностей устройства. Коммутатор содержит M-плат 1.1-1.М коммутации, N-входных измерительных сигналов, счетчики 2 и 3, дешифраторы 4 и 5, задающий генератор 6, блок 7 временной задержки, управляемый высокочастотный генератор 10, блок 11 запрета, элементы И 12 и 13, элементы ИЛИ 14, 15 и 16, триггер 18 и переключающие устройства 21 и 22. Введение аналогового переключателя 8, блока 9 управления, элемента ИЛИ 17, формирователей 19 и 20, блоков 23 и 24 сквозно..о переноса и образование новых функциональных связей позволяет уменьшить время аналого-цифровых прес- разователей, а автоматизация процесса предварительной установки номеров плат и каналов измерения на них, участвующих в процессе измерения, расширяет круг задач, решаемых на аналого-цифровых вычислительных комплексах. 4 ил.
1272494
Изобретение относится к вычислительной и кдммутационной технике.
Цель изобретения — повышение быстродействия и расширение функциональных возможностей. 5
На фиг. 1 приведена структурная схема коммутатора; на фиг. 2 — функциональная схема первого переключающего устройства (схема второго переключающего устройства аналогична); 10 на фиг. 3 — функциональная схема первого блока сквозного переноса (схема второго блока сквозного переноса аналогична); на фиг, 4 — функциональная схема блока управления. 15
Коммутатор (фиг. 1) содержит .
М-плат 1.1, 1.2-1.М коммутации N входных измерительных сигналов, первый счетчик. 2, второй счетчик 3, первый дешифратор 4, второй дешифратор 5, задающий генератор 6, блок 7 временной задержки, аналоговый переключатель 8, блок 9 управления, управляемый высокочастотный генератор
10, блок 11 запрета, первый элемент 25
И 12, второй элемент И 13 первый элемент ИЛИ 14, второй элемент ИЛИ
15, третий элемент ИЛИ 16, четвертый элемент ИЛИ 17, триггер 18, первый формирователь 19, второй формирователь 20, первое переключающее устройство 21, второе переключающее устройство 22, первый блок 23 и второй блок 24 сквозного переноса.
Первое переключающее устройства
21 (фиг. 2) содержит первый элемент
25 задержки, буферный регистр 26, первый элемент ИЛИ 27, второй элемент ИЛИ 28, мультиплексор 29, второй элемент 30 задержки, третий элемент ИПИ 31, четвертый элемент ИЛИ
32, блок 33 памяти, сдвиговый регистр 34.
Первый блок 23 сквозного переноса (фиг. 3) содержит первый элемент И
35, элемент ИЛИ 36, первый элемент 37 задержки, первый одновибратор 38, первый инвертор 39, второй инвертор
40, второй одновибратор 41, триггер
42, второй элемент И 43, второй элемент 44 задержки, каналы 45.1- .
45.(1.-1) переноса, каждый иэ которых состоит из формирователя 46, первого триггера 47,,первого и второго элементов И 48 и 49и второго триггера 50. 55
Блок 9 управления (фиг. 4) содержит первый триггер 51, элемент И-HE .52, второй триггер 53 и элемент И 54.
Коммутатор работает следующим образом.
По сигналу с шины "Сброс" первый
23 и второй 24 блоки и сквозного переноса и блок 9 управления устанавливаются в исходное положение, счетчики 2,3 — в "0", триггер 18 — в "1", При этом выходные шины счетчиков 2 и 3 и блоков 23 и 24 сквозного переноса устанавливаются в пассивном состоянии, на выходе аналогового переключателя 8 скоммутирован выход нечетной группы плат 1.1, 1.3-1.(М-1) коммутации, а блок ll запрета, запрещает прохождение импульсов задающего генератора 6 к входу триггера 18, Перед началом работы в переключающие устройства 21 и 22 с информационного канала заносятся данные о номерах плат и входных измерительных сигналах (измерительных каналах) на платах, участвующих в процессе измерения, а также начальные условия рабо-. ты коммутатора. Переключающее устройство 21 совместно с блоком 23 сквозного переноса, счетчиком 2 и дешифратором 4 управляет нечетной группой плат 1.1, 1.3-1.(М-1) коммутации.
Переключающее устройство 22 совместно с блоком 24 сквозного переноса, счетчиком 3 и дешифратором 5 управляет четной группой плат 1.2, 1.4-1.М коммутации..
Блок управления нечетной группой плат коммутации работает следующим образом.
По сигналу "Пуск" на выходе блока
23 сквозного переноса устанавливается сигнал Упр., определяющий номер первой платы из группы 1.1, 1.3-l.(M-l), участвующей в процессе измерения.
При необходимости пропуска каналов на выбранной плате переключающее устройство 21 через элемент ИЛИ 14 запускает высокочастотный генератор
10 и через элементы И 12, ИЛИ 15 на счетный вход счетчика 2 подаются импульсы пропуска каналов, контролируемые переключающим устройством 21. По сигналу "Пуск" блок 9 управления отсекает первый импульс задающего генератора 6 и дает разрешение на прохождение следующих через блок ll запрета к счетному входу триггера 18, работающего по схеме делителя на
tip ll
Сигнал с единичного выхода триггера 18 управляет состоянием аналого3 1272 вого переключателя 8 и через формирователь 19 и элемент ИЛИ 15 по каждому второму импульсу с задающего генератора 6 увеличивает содержимое счетчика 2 на "1", устанавливая тем самым на выходных шинах дешифратора
4 номер следующего канала измерения на выбранной плате коммутации. По сигналу переноса "Pl" с выхода счетчика 2, информирующему о том, что 10 все каналы на данной плате опрошены, блок управления также, как и по сигналу "Пуск", определяет номер следующей платы и канала на ней, участвующих в измерениях. Установка и 15 пропуск каналов измерения и плат нечетной группы плат коммутации происходят в промежуток времени, когда на шине "И подключен выход четной еых группы плат коммутации и наоборот. щ
Блок управления четной группой плат 1.2, 1.4-1.М коммутации работает аналогично схеме управления нечетной группы плат, только по сигналу "Пуск" они работают параллельно, 2s а в дальнейшем последовательно, в противофазе.
Во время пропуска или переключения каналов измерения блок 7 временной задержки выдает сигнал "Конец операции", управляющий блоком 9 и информирующий о конце переходных процессов в коммутаторе.
Первое переключающее устройство
21 работает следующим образом.
В исходном состоянии мультиплексор 29 подключает к адресным входам
А1-А? блока 33 памяти управляющие шины блока 23 сквозного переноса, регистр 34 установлен в режиме "Сдвиг40 влево", блок 33 памяти — в режиме
"Чтение". Предварительная установка номеров плат коммутации и каналов на них, участвующих в процессе измерения, начинается сигналом "Запись, 2", по которому с информационного канала в буферный регистр 26 запоминается номер первой платы коммутации.
По сигналу "Запись 1" выходы буферного регистра 26 через мультиплексор
29 подключаются к адресным входам блока 33 памяти, который переводится в режиме "Запись". По сигналу "Запись 1" через элемент ИЛИ 31 в блоке
33 запоминаются номера каналов первой платы, участвующие в измерениях, передаваемые по шинам информационного канала. Запоминание номеров каналов г
494 4 измерения ост;льных плат коммутации происходит аналогично. Начальные условия коммутации каналов измерения первой платы запоминаются в блоке
33 памяти по адресу и по концу сигнала "Запись 1", сигналом "С" с блока 23 сквозного переноса записываются в сдвиговый,регистр 34. 3апись содержимого блока 33 памяти в сдвиговый регистр 34 может осуществиться также по сигналам "Pl" со счетчика 2 и "В" с блока 23 сквозного переноса. При этом, если на выходе сдвигового регистра 34 установлена логическая "1" означающая, что первый канал надо пропустить, первый элемент ИЛИ 14 запускает высокочастотный генератор 10, первый импульс которого через первый элемент И 12, второй элемент ИЛИ 15 увеличивает содержимое счетчика 2 на "1" и на один такт сдвигает "влево" содержимое,регистра 34. Данный процесс повторяется до тех пор, пока на выходе регистра 34 не установится состояние логического "0". При этом пропуск каналов прекращается. В конце предварительной установки по сигналу
"Запись 2" в регистре 26 записываются номера всех плат коммутации, участвующих в процессе измерения.
В момент начального запуска и в процессе коммутации переключающее устройство 21 работает по сигналам
"В, "Pl" и сигналу с элемента ИЛИ
15. При необходимости в переключающем устройстве 21 может быть применена известная схема блокировки блока 33 памяти от пропадания питания основного источника.
Второе переключающее устройство
22 работает аналогично.
Первый блок 23 сквозного переноса работает следующим образом.
Сигнал "Сброс" устанавливает все элементы памяти блока 23 в исходное положение. По заднему фронту сигнала
"Запись 1" и сигналу "1" на выходе одновибратора 41 и блока 23 сквозного переноса появляется сигнал "С", устанавливающий триггер 42 в единичное состояние, Это соответствует процессу задания начальных условий коммутации каналов измерения первой ,платы в ре вом переключающем устройстве 21, По переднему фронту сигнала
"Пуск" на выходе "0" первого одновибратора 38 появляется импульс, по ко-.
5 1272 торому в первый триггер 47 каналов
45.1-45,(L-1) сквозного переноса записывается состояние шин блока 23 сквозного переноса. Пассивное состояние шины информирует о том, что соответствующая плата коммутации должна быть пропущена. Через элемент 37 задержки и элемент ИЛИ 36 сигнал с выхода "Ц" одновибратора 38 опрашивает каналы 45.1-45.(? -1) и устанавли- !О вает на выходных управляющих шинах блока 23 сквозного переноса адрес первой платы коммутации. По заднему фронту сигнала "Пуск" триггер 42 устанавливается в нулевом состоянии.
При отсутствии сигнала L сигнал
11 11 Пуск " действует согласно описанному алгоритму и, кроме того, ч ер е э элеи е н т 4 4 з аде ржкн и элемент И 4 3 формир у ет сигнал " В ", который в и е р е клю- 2О ч ающем устройстве 2 1 по адресу платы коммутации, установленному на шинах бл о к а 2 3 сквозного переноса, переписыв а е т иэ блока 3 3 памяти в сдвиго вый р е ги с тр 34 данные о порядке комму т а - 25 ц ии каналов измерения на выбранной плате . По сигналу "Р 1 ", информирую- ° щему о том, ч то н а выбранной плате в с е каналы из мерени я опрошены, на выходных управляющих шинах блока 2 3 с к в о з но го переноса выдается адрес следующей пла ты коммутации, по которомуу и ере ключ ающе е устройство 2 1 опр еделя е т порядок коммутации каналов измерения на н ей . Сигнал с выхода элемента H 49 канала 45.(L-1) переключения, информирующий о том, что все платы нечетной группы опрошены, запускает одновибратор 38, выход "Q" которого запрещает сигнал "Р1" и ус- щ танавливает на выходных управляющих шинах блока 23 сквозного переноса адрес первой платы коммутации. В дальнейшем работа блока 23 сквозного переноса циклически повторяется. IS
Второй блок 24 сквозного переноса работает аналогично.
Блок 9 управления работает следующим образом. 1
По сигналу "Сброс" триггеры 51 и 53 устанавливаются в нулевое состояние и на выходе блока 9 управления присутствует запрещающий сигнал., Сигнал "Пуск",устанавливает триггер
51 в состояние, разрешающее работу элемента И 52, который по концу первого импульса с задающего генератора
6 устанавливает триггер 53 в единич-i
494 ное состояние, и на выходе элемента
И 54 при отсутствии сигнала "Конец операции появляется разрешающий сигнал.
Таким образом, построение схемы пропуска плат коммутации ло принципу сквозного переноса и организация процесса измерения в начале по каналу нечетной группы плат коммутации с одновременной подготовкой канала измерения четной группы плат, а затем наоборот, позволяет уменьшить время аналого-цифровых (АЦП) преобразований многоканальных АЦП, а автоматизация процесса предварительной установки номеров плат и каналов измерения на них, участвующих в процессе измерения, расширяет круг задач, .решаемых на аналого-цифровых вычислительных комплексах.
Формула изобретения
Коммутатор, содержащий М-плат коммутации входных измерительных сигналов, каждая из которых объединяет по выходу группу из И-каналов с объединенным выходом плат, первый и второй счетчики, первые выходы которых через соответствующие дешифраторы соединены с управляющими входами плат коммутации, задающий генератор, соединенный .с блоком запрета, блок .временной задержки сигнала, выход которого соединен с выходной шиной
"конец операции", первое и второе переключающее устройство, причем первый выход первого переключающего устройства соединен через первый вход первого элемента ИЛИ с высокочастотным генератором и через первый вход первого элемента И с первым входом второго элемента ИЛИ, выход которого соединен со счетным входом первого счетчика, выход высокочастотного генератора соединен с вторым входом первого элемента И и через первый вход второго элемента И вЂ” с первым входом третьего элемента ИЛИ, выход которого соединен со счетным входом второго счетчика, первый выход второго переключающего устройства соединен с вторым входом первого элемента
ИПИ и с вторым входом второго элемента И, отличающийся тем, что, с целью повышения быстродействия и расширения функциональных возможностей, И-плат коммутации объединены в нечетную и четную группы и
7 12 введен аналоговый переключатель, четвертый элемент ИЛИ, первый и второй формирователь, триггер, блок управления, первый и второй блок сквозного переноса, пфичем первые входы первого и второго переключающего устройства соединены с информационной шиной, вторые и третьи входы — с первыми счетными входами и вторыми выходами соответствующих счетчиков, вторые выходы — с первыми входами сооответствующих блоков сквозного переноса, первые выходы которых соединены с третьими входами соответствующих переключающих устройств и с управляющими шинами нечетных и четных групп плат коммутации, вторые входы блоков сквозного переноса соединены с шиной "Пуск", а третьи— с шиной "Сброс", которая соединена с первым входом блока управления, S-входом триггера и с вторыми входами счетчиков, шина "Пуск" соединена также с вторым входом блока управле72494 8 ния, третий вход которого соединен с выходом задающего генератора, четвертый вход — с выходной шиной "конец операции", а выход блока управления с вторым входом блока запрета, выход которого соединен с С-входом триггера, инверсный выход которого соединен с его D-входом и с входом второго формирователя, выход которо10 го соединен с вторым входом третьего элемента ИЛИ, выход которого — с первым входом четвертого элемента ИЛИ, второй вход которого соединен с выходом второго элемента ИЛИ, а выf5 ход — с входом блока временной задержки, прямой выход триггера соединен через первый формирователь с вторым входом второго элемента ИНИ и с первым входом аналогового переключа20 теля, второй и третий входы которого соединены соответственно с выходами нечетной и четной групп плат коммутации, а выход — с выходной ши— ной.
1272494
1272494
1 272494
С заращен
Составитель Л. Багян
Редактор Л. Гратилло Техред А.Кравчук Корректор И. 11уска
Заказ 6349/56 тираж 816 Подписное
ВНИИПЙ Государственного комитета СССР по делам изобретений и открытий
113035, Москва, Ж-35, Раушская наб., д. 4/5
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4







